Carolyn Fay Roberts, 77, of Louisville, Kentucky passed away on Friday, August 18, 2017.

She was born in Logsdon Valley, Kentucky on April 24, 1940 to the late Rutherford and Stella Mae Bridgeman-Crain.

In addition to her parents Carolyn was preceded in death by one son, Eric Roberts.

Carolyn is survived by her beloved family including one daughter, Jamie Gibson; three sons, Jeffrey Roberts, William Kevin (Amber) Roberts, and Kyle (Melanie) Roberts; two brothers, James (Gayle) Crain and Gary (Phyllis) Crain; one sister, Beverly Fields; four grandsons, Brad Roberts, Dalton Gibson, Cameron Gibson and Carter Roberts; two granddaughters, Lauren Roberts and Kayla Roberts as well as a host of extended family members and friends all of whom will cherish her memory.

In loving memory of Carolyn, the family suggest contributions be made to Hosparus of Louisville.

There will be a Memorial Gathering held to Celebrate Carolyn's Life on Saturday, August 26, 2017 at 4:00 pm at Greenville United Methodist Church, 9449 Harrison Street, Greenville, Indiana 47124.
